Cleaning out the hosel on a driver head and there seems to be no bottom to the hosel. Is this something to be concerned about?
There is generally a small plug at the bottom of the hosel. just empty out any loose items you can hear rattling around in the head, then just put a hosel plug in. You can buy things like this:
http://www.billybobsgolf.com/product.php?productid=17610
Or just cut or punch a small circle out of aluminium can. It's job is to stop any shafting epoxy running down into the head.
Yes, they make small plastic plugs to cover the hole so the epoxy doesn't drip into the head. I have cut a plastic disk out of milk jug. Slightly glue it in the day before. They use the hole to hot melt the head.
